Billy Bragg on Skiffle and Music as Resistance

Influenced as much by punk as folk music, England’s great singer/songwriter Billy Bragg has always placed politics and social activism at the center of his creative life. Bragg has a new book out about the history and impact of skiffle: Roots, Radicals, and Rockers.
He paused during his book tour to talk about why he wrote the book (1:00); examples of genre mixing in music that don’t qualify as cultural appropriation (2:50); hip-hop as the musical language of today (5:15); music as revolution, citing the example of Beyonce (6:15); the importance of empathy in music (10:30); and why his best songs connect with audiences (13:00).
